American boxer Ryan Garcia recalled his fight against current WBO Welterweight champion Devin Haney. In that bout, Ryan dropped his opponent and won by decision. However, the fight was later ruled a no-contest due to Garcia’s positive doping tests.

“I’m still going to show him who’s the boss here, who his real father is.

Bill isn’t his real father — I’m his real father. I want you to go to his page and tell him that.

When you got beat from start to finish… I’m his real father, and that’s facts,” said Garcia.

After that fight, Ryan boxed once — he lost to Rolando Romero. His next opponent will be Mario Barrios, the WBC Welterweight champion.

Devin Haney has fought twice since that meeting — defeating Jose Carlos Ramirez and Brian Norman by decision. After the second fight, Devin became the WBO champion at Welterweight.
